Appleton North is 2-8 against Kimberly since April of 2018 but they'll have a chance to close the gap a little bit on Thursday. The Appleton North Lightning will be playing at home against the Kimberly Papermakers at 4:30 p.m.
Appleton North was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their eighth straight defeat. They wound up on the wrong side of a tough 12-1 walloping at the hands of Oshkosh West.
Appleton North saw five different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Alyssa Wald, who scored a run while going 3-for-3.
Meanwhile, while Kimberly put up some runs on Tuesday, the same can't be said for Appleton East. Kimberly put the hurt on Appleton East with a sharp 10-0 victory. That's two games straight that Kimberly has won by exactly ten runs.
Appleton North's loss dropped their record down to 0-2. As for Kimberly, they pushed their record up to 2-0 with that win, which was their seventh straight at home dating back to last season.
Appleton North suffered a grim 9-1 defeat to Kimberly when the teams last played back in May of 2023. Can Appleton North av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
